The Rise of the Supporting Role (2013-2018): Building a Foundation

Before his breakout roles, Pedro Pascal honed his craft, building a strong foundation through a series of compelling supporting roles. This period was crucial in developing his skills and establishing a distinctive screen presence.

Early Career Highlights:

  • Game of Thrones (2013-2016): His portrayal of Oberyn Martell, despite a relatively short arc, left an indelible mark on audiences. The character's charisma and tragic fate cemented Pascal's ability to portray complex and memorable characters, showcasing his range as a character actor.
  • Narcos (2015-2017): This Netflix series offered Pascal a chance to display his intensity and gravitas as Javier Peña, a DEA agent. The role demonstrated his ability to handle complex storylines and carry emotional weight, further showcasing his versatility.
  • Kingsman: The Golden Circle (2017): This action-comedy proved Pascal could move seamlessly between genres, further strengthening his position as a versatile performer capable of taking on diverse character types.

Developing a Strong Screen Presence:

Even in supporting roles, Pascal consistently commanded attention. His ability to convey both vulnerability and strength, combined with his natural charisma, made him a memorable presence on screen.

  • Oberyn Martell's iconic fight scene in Game of Thrones: This moment highlighted Pascal's physicality and acting prowess, showcasing his ability to captivate audiences even in intense, action-packed scenes.
  • Javier Peña's unwavering determination in Narcos: This demonstrated his capacity for portraying morally complex characters with depth and nuance, highlighting his talent as a character actor.

The Breakthrough: The Mandalorian and Global Recognition (2019-2020)

The year 2019 marked a turning point in Pascal's career. His casting as the titular Mandalorian in the Disney+ series The Mandalorian transformed him into a global phenomenon.

The Impact of The Mandalorian:

  • Din Djarin's iconic role: The stoic yet ultimately compassionate Mandalorian warrior resonated deeply with audiences, becoming a symbol of the show's immense success.
  • A cultural phenomenon: The Mandalorian quickly became a global sensation, propelling Pascal into the mainstream and securing his place as a leading man.
  • Breakthrough performance: His portrayal of Din Djarin showcased his range and ability to connect with audiences without relying on dialogue, further cementing his leading man status.

Consolidating Leading Man Status (2021-Present): A Diverse Portfolio

Following the success of The Mandalorian, Pedro Pascal continued to choose ambitious and diverse projects, solidifying his position as a top-tier leading man.

The Last of Us:

  • Joel Miller's complex character: Pascal's portrayal of the gruff but ultimately loving Joel Miller in HBO's The Last of Us adaptation received widespread critical acclaim.
  • Award-worthy performance: His performance showcases emotional depth and range, displaying the complexities of grief, loyalty, and fatherhood.
  • Leading role in a critical and commercial success: The show's success and critical acclaim cemented Pascal's status as a leading man capable of carrying a major television series.
